#AskTheDoctor What food i should give my son for vit D deficiency?

A. You should first of all expose the baby to direct sunlight 30 mins a day and in veg diet not much options like fortified cereals eggs and other non veg foods should be given

A. hi dear Some examples of foods with vitamin D include: Some fish (for example, salmon or light canned tuna). Eggs. Vitamin D-fortified products like plain whole cow's milk (for children 12 months and older), yogurt, cereals, and some 100% juices.
